Milk Chocolate Florentine Cookies

  Servings: 3

Ingredients

  • 2/3 c. butter
  • 2 c. quick cooking oats -- uncooked
  • 1 c. sugar
  • 2/3 c. all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 c. corn syrup
  • 1/4 c. lowfat milk
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 2 c. lowfat milk chocolate chips

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. Heat butter in medium saucepan over low heat.
  2. Remove from heat. Stir in oats, sugar, flour, corn syrup, lowfat milk, vanilla, and salt; mix well. Drop by level teaspoonfuls, about 3 inches apart, onto foil-lined cookie sheets. Spread thin with rubber spatula. Bake at 375 degrees F. for 5 to 7 min. Cold completely. Peel foil away from cookies. Heat over warm (not boiling) water, lowfat milk chocolate chips; stir till smooth. Spread chocolate on flat side of half the cookies. Top with remaining cookies.
  3. Yield: about 3 1/2 dozen (2 cookies per serving).
